1. Fall Risk and Hip Fractures: A Global Health Concern
Falls among elderly individuals, especially those aged 65 and older, are alarmingly common, with studies showing that approximately 1 in 4 seniors fall every year. The consequences of falls are severe, leading to fractures, limited mobility, and a significant decline in independence. Among the most vulnerable fractures is the hip fracture, which is associated with high mortality and morbidity rates in older adults.
Key Fall Risk Factors:
· Weak muscle strength
· Poor balance and coordination
· Osteoporosis
· Reduced vision or cognitive function
· Environmental hazards
As the prevalence of fall-related injuries rises, solutions that reduce fall risk become critical for seniors’ safety. Rollators, designed with enhanced stability, are one of the most effective mobility aids for seniors with these risk factors.
2. Rollator Stability Support Mechanism: A Structural Breakdown
The rollator’s stability is largely determined by its frame structure, support points, and adjustable components. These features are specifically designed to improve balance, reduce risk of falls, and offer essential support during walking.
Key Features of Rollator Stability:
• Frame Structure
A robust, lightweight frame with a wide base ensures better balance and even weight distribution, which prevents tipping.
• Support Points
· Handles and Handgrips: Ergonomically designed handles allow for a firm grip, distributing weight evenly and enhancing stability.
· Front and Rear Wheels: Larger wheels provide stability on uneven terrain, such as grass or cobblestones.
· Seat and Backrest: For users who need breaks during walks, a stable seat offers rest while minimizing the risk of sudden falls.
• Adjustable Components
· Handle Height Adjustments: Customizable handle height ensures proper posture and reduces stress on joints, minimizing the risk of injury.
· Brake Systems: High-quality brakes prevent uncontrolled movement, adding to overall safety.
3. The Role of Rollators in Preventing Hip Fractures
Rollators are not just about mobility; they are key to hip fracture prevention. By providing support and stability, rollators help users maintain a natural walking posture and reduce strain on the hips and joints.
· Preventing falls: A rollator stabilizes the user, making it less likely to fall while walking, especially in risky situations like walking on slippery or uneven surfaces.
· Promoting independent movement: With increased confidence in mobility, seniors are more likely to stay active, which improves bone density and joint strength.
· Improving balance: Consistent walking with the support of a rollator helps seniors maintain coordination and posture, critical factors in preventing falls.
